自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(6)
  • 收藏
  • 关注

原创 php实现多文件压缩,并返回给浏览器下载

"data" => "下载失败,原因:" . $file["file_name"] . "文件不存在"$url = implode("/", $sliceUrl);//在将数组最后的两个值变成一个字符串。//获取数组最后两个值。"data" => "服务器异常,请稍后再试!"data" => "files不能为空"//创建一个压缩文件,以当前毫秒数为名称,注意释放这个zip流。"data" => "创建压缩包失败"// 设置响应头,告诉浏览器返回的是一个流。//如果请求体没有files或者为空则返回错误。

2023-08-26 20:18:02 170

原创 mysql树形查询

mysql8 的新特性。

2023-08-18 21:21:20 175 1

原创 mybatis-plus查找数据一条数据时提示无法类型转换或查找多条数据时会提示调用selectone方法。

出现这个问题时题主使用的是springboot+mybatis,后面看到mybatis-plus更好于是便更换了mybatisplus的依赖。但是在我查找一条数据时就出现了标题上的问题。废话不多说,贴上报错信息:classsCastException:class com.example.hongwanround.springstudy.Entiy.User cannot be cast to class com.baomidou.mybatisplus.extension.plugins.paginat

2022-04-17 21:46:13 1678

原创 Java实现对字符串进行ASCII码从小到大的排序

ASCII排序的实现原理:先把字符串转换为一个的char型数组,接着使用冒泡排序把char型数组的每一个字符转化为int类型然后进行判断。(提示:本次使用的冒泡排序有个缺点,一旦有大量的数组进行排序,那么执行起来的效率就会慢很多)。 String str = "helloworld"; //这里的字符串可更改其他内容 char[] c = str.toCharArray(); for (int i = 0; i < c.length - 1; i++) {

2021-06-24 23:29:42 5700 1

原创 ThinkPHP5.1在数据库中随机筛选不重复数据

前言:在我处理项目中遇到一个非常有意思的问题,甲方那边想要我们从数据库里面随机筛选几条数据且不重复的数据,一开始我的想法是计算数据库中的id总和,然后使用while循环随机生成数字并在数据库中直到寻找7条为止,但我测接口的时候发现这种实现的方法有两种缺点:1.如果每次随机数对不上id,那么代码中会跑很多很多次,而且很会影响程序的速度。2.每次生成的随机数会有相同值,会导致在数据库在搜索数据的时会有至少两条相同的数据。于是就在想那我能不能在数据库中...

2021-06-20 21:14:19 890

原创 mysql数据库中如何表自链接

在我们要实现某些业务逻辑中,数据表中的某一个字段是对应本表的id,但是我们发现通过普通的sql语句是达到不了我们想要中的效果

2021-06-20 13:58:43 1099 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除